Output 6eb868d3b09f332e41d8c9ca1febc2742e16f5fd45c2e635ee3e8c680b9675ce:1

value
25677
script pubkey
OP_0 OP_PUSHBYTES_20 e1c04150c15bb8d31d3108b84d3ddbb3edc22fce
address
bc1qu8qyz5xptwudx8f3pzuy60wmk0kuyt7w2krhwa
transaction
6eb868d3b09f332e41d8c9ca1febc2742e16f5fd45c2e635ee3e8c680b9675ce